Vodafone - cancelling contract

Simple question - I have been a Vodafone pay monthly customer for approx 3 years (I am not sure what the original length of the contract was, suspect 12 months).

If I cancel, should I expect to be able to keep the phone? (a Nokia 7650, which is unlocked).

  • Yes you can keep the phone and if you want to take your number to another network ask for a PAC code which lets you do it. You do not have to give notice to cancel as you are out of contract, especially if you use a PAC code which cancels you automatically.

    You do need to give 30 days notice even after the 12 months, as the contract is still in place, the contract doesn't end after 12 months, it is on going until you finish it

    It is always 30 days notice to cancel with Vodafone.

    Usually people do it in month 11 so the contract does finish after the signed 12 months.
